15:23:51 TheJulia random question, are there any thoughts regarding letting a compute driver throttling such that we don't have timeout failures ? Thinking once in a blue moon someone trying to create a 1000 physical machine deployments in ironic and they just want to batch them all up at once.
15:23:56 johnthetubaguy gibi: all good :)
15:24:58 sean-k-mooney TheJulia: there is a config option you can set that kind of does that
15:25:08 sean-k-mooney TheJulia: not sure if it works with ironic
15:25:11 TheJulia oh?
15:25:27 sean-k-mooney https://docs.openstack.org/nova/latest/configuration/config.html#DEFAULT.max_concurrent_builds
15:25:35 sean-k-mooney max concurent builds
15:25:43 sean-k-mooney its a compute agent config
15:26:08 johnthetubaguy until recent releases, the scheduler used to fall over first though, in theory better now, but hope to be testing that more soon
15:26:10 sean-k-mooney so you could set that per ironic conpute service
15:26:28 sean-k-mooney johnthetubaguy: multi create still sucks
15:26:42 sean-k-mooney johnthetubaguy: it has less races with plamcnet
15:27:00 sean-k-mooney but unless we change how retires work anti affingity server groups break things
